Browns QB Keenum joins Mayfield on Covid-19 Reserve list
Cleveland Browns backup quarterback CASE KEENUM joined starting quarterback BAKER MAYFIELD on the Covid-19 Reserve list on Thursday. Keenum’s positive test leaves third-string quarterback NICK MULLENS as the possible starter heading… More into Saturday’s game against the Las Vegas Raiders. The NFL and NFLPA agreed to new rules for this weekend’s games which make it possible for any asymptomatic vaccinated players to make it back in time for the game, providing they test negative once along with a negative rapid test. Previously, players needed two negative tests 24 hours apart to be activated. Stay tuned, fantasy owners. Less

Minshew Mania heading to Philadelphia
The Philadelphia Eagles traded a conditional late-round draft pick to the Jacksonville Jaguars for quarterback GARDNER MINSHEW over the weekend. While “Minshew Mania” appears to be a thing of the past,… More Minshew does strengthen the Eagles depth in the quarterback room. The Eagles cut quarterback NICK MULLENS after acquiring Minshew, so the QB room now consists of starter JALEN HURTS, presumed backup JOE FLACCO, and Minshew. Less

49ers QB Mullens ready to roll in 2021
San Francisco backup quarterback NICK MULLENS underwent successful elbow surgery in late-December and is progressing to the point that he is expected to be healthy by the start of training camp. There was initially some concern that Mullens might require Tommy John surgery, but that was fortunately not the case.

49ers QB Mullens done for 2020 season
San Francisco quarterback NICK MULLENS suffered an elbow sprain during Sunday’s game against the Dallas Cowboys and is likely done for the season. Head coach Kyle Shanahan said that Mullens is… More experiencing swelling and the team is considering possible “Tommy John” surgery that would force him to miss approximately six weeks. Backup quarterback C.J. BEATHARD is likely to get the start for the remaining two games of the season, although JIMMY GAROPPOLO is still working his way back from injury. Less

Mullens era to continue in San Francisco
The San Francisco 49ers will continue with NICK MULLENS as their starting quarterback when the team plays the New York Giants on Monday night. Mullens, a former undrafted free agent and third-string quarterback, had an impressive debut against the Oakland Raiders last weekend.

Third-string quarterback leads 49ers
Third-string quarterback NICK MULLENS started his first NFL game on Thursday night, leading the San Francisco 49ers over the Oakland Raiders. Friends and family aside, Mullens likely didn’t have any fantasy owners to celebrate his 3-touchdown performance against a terrible, horrible, no good, very bad Raiders defense.
